To use your 653X device with cables, signal conditioning modules, and
other accessories that require an AT-DIO-32F pinout, use the R6850-D1,
an optional 68-to-50-pin device adapter. Using a PSHR68-68M shielded
cable, you can also connect the adapter to a DAQCard 6533 device.

The female side of the R6850-D1 adapter connects directly to the
653X device or PSHR68-68M cable. The male side of the adapter provides
the pin assignments shown in Figure C-2. The 50-pin adapter has no +5 V,
CPULL, or DPULL pins.

Optional Equipment for Connecting Signals

National Instruments offers a variety of accessories to extend your
653X device capabilities, including:

Cables and cable assemblies, shielded and ribbon

Connector blocks, shielded and unshielded 50 and 68-pin screw
terminals

RTSI bus cables for AT and PCI devices

SCXI modules and accessories that can acquire up to 3072 channels,
and that can isolate, amplify, excite, and multiplex signals for relays
and analog output

Low channel-count signal conditioning modules, devices, and
accessories, including conditioning for strain gauges and RTDs,
simultaneous sample and hold, relays, and optical isolation
